Vertical Price-Fixing
An illegal practice where parties at different levels of the same supply chain (like manufacturers and retailers) agree to control the prices at which a product must be sold.
Per Se
A Latin phrase meaning "by itself" or "in itself," used to indicate something that is inherently or intrinsically the case.
Tying Agreements
Contracts where the buyer is required to purchase one product in order to buy another product, often considered anti-competitive.
